Campo Grande, Brazil
Maceió, State of Alagoas, Brazil
3533.35 km
46h 35mins
106.0 kgs
2391.86 km
7h 34mins
258.32 kgs
2959.66 km
38h 26mins
378.84 kgs
Tranport Distance Time(hrs) Cost(local) Cost(usd)
Bus 3533.35 km 46h 35mins 361 BRL 157.44
Flight 2391.86 km 7h 34mins 507 BRL 220.90362
Drive 2959.66 km 38h 26mins 745 BRL 324.45
Take Taxi from Campo Grande to Campo Grande Bus Station
Time: 13mins Cost: 21 BRL; $ 8.1 - 9.9 USD CO2 Emission: 1.48 kgs
Take Bus from Campo Grande Bus Station to Rio de Janeiro Bus Station
Time: 25h 40mins Cost: 149 BRL; $ 58.5 - 71.5 USD CO2 Emission: 43.47 kgs
Take Bus from Rio de Janeiro - Novo Rio to Maceió
Time: 19h 42mins Cost: 207 BRL; $ 81.0 - 99.0 USD CO2 Emission: 62.19 kgs
Source: Rome2rio

The best and cheapest way to get from Campo Grande, Brazil and Maceió, State of Alagoas, Brazil is to travel by bus, which will cost about 360 BRL or 141.30 USD.